Transaction 5a2062525056633ff353170bfacabe062e572431c4cc51af9aff9165a9508e3b

1 Input
2 Outputs
  • 5a2062525056633ff353170bfacabe062e572431c4cc51af9aff9165a9508e3b:0
  • value  1000000
    address  2MwXndSNLYbD9smwjmuMDFdQMW3ccGN9dLx
  • 5a2062525056633ff353170bfacabe062e572431c4cc51af9aff9165a9508e3b:1
  • value  16361683
    address  mrw8egXHsPWZrYMXKRK8Y2DTHNu6817CuL